Category: Baserunning
Type: Drill

BASE




The runner is on the base in her ready position (ready for her lead off). Another player or coach is a short distance from her, in the basepath from 1st to 2nd base. The coach holds a tennis ball at eye height. As the ball is dropped on a piece of flat wood, the runner leaves the base and attempts to catch the ball before it bounces off the wood a second time. The distance for this drill is determined by the skill level of the runners, but start out close so that she can easily catch the ball and slowly move back to challenge her.
